EpicQuest Education Group International Limited (NASDAQ:EEIQ) Sees Significant Drop in Short Interest
by Mitch Edgeman · The Markets DailyEpicQuest Education Group International Limited (NASDAQ:EEIQ –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a large drop in short interest in January. As of January 15th, there was short interest totaling 59,649 shares, a drop of 51.2% from the December 31st total of 122,356 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 433,582 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.1 days. Approximately 0.3% of the shares of the stock are short sold. Institutional Trading of EpicQuest Education Group International
An institutional investor recently bought a new position in EpicQuest Education Group International stock. Sabby Management LLC purchased a new stake in shares of EpicQuest Education Group International Limited (NASDAQ:EEIQ – Free Report) in the 3rd qu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or purchased 900,765 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$401,000. EpicQuest Education Group International accounts for approximately 0.5% of Sabby Management LLC’s holdings, making the stock its 13th largest holding. Sabby Management LLC owned about 3.85% of EpicQuest Education Group International at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About EpicQuest Education Group International
EpicQuest Education Group International, Inc (NASDAQ: EEIQ) is a U.S.-listed holding company whose primary operations are conducted through its China-based subsidiaries focused on after-school English language immersion programs for K-12 students. The company aims to bridge language gaps by delivering structured English curricula that blend core language skills with cultural enrichment activities. EpicQuest’s model combines in-person instruction at its network of local learning centers with supplemental online resources to reinforce student engagement and learning outcomes.
EpicQuest offers a diverse suite of educational services, including weekday after-school classes, weekend workshops, holiday and summer camps, and study abroad preparation modules.
